₹ 8,373 - ₹ 11,212
|CHEAPEST CITY IN JAMAICA||Ocho Rios||14% cheaper||Hotels in Ocho Rios are the cheapest in Jamaica at just ₹ 8,373 per night on average.|
|MOST EXPENSIVE CITY IN JAMAICA||Montego Bay||14% more expensive||Montego Bay has the highest priced hotels in Jamaica with rooms averaging ₹ 11,212 per night.|
|MOST POPULAR CITY IN JAMAICA||Montego Bay||40% more users visited||More momondo users search for hotels in Montego Bay than any other city in Jamaica|
At just ₹ 21,683 per night on average, May is the least expensive month to stay at a hotel in Jamaica. The most expensive month to stay at a hotel in Jamaica is March.
Our users tend to visit Montego Bay more often than any other city when travelling to Jamaica.
Expect to pay about ₹ 46,337 per night when booking a luxury hotel room in Jamaica. Rates for luxury hotel rooms are typically 190% more than the average hotel room in Jamaica, which costs ₹ 15,976 each night.
Montego Bay is the most expensive city in Jamaica to book a hotel room in. The nightly rate of ₹ 11,212 is 14% more than the average city in Jamaica.
At just ₹ 1,690 per night, Montego Bay has hotel room rates that are 89% less than other cities in Jamaica.